I have 2 questions regarding tithing. My wife and I have been cheerfully tithing a great deal for the past several years (and especially this past year) and then in December we became disappointed in our church because it seemed that they began placing a huge emphasis on tithing to help with a huge expansion of church facilities that is being financed from loans. Neither my wife or I agree with a church taking out large loans for expansion, especially when the existing facility is plenty sufficient. (At all Sunday sermons etc each week there is only about 50 per cent capacity.) It seems like the church would focus on filling the pews before expanding the facilities. Now I am at a point where I have written checks for year end tithes but I have been wrestling with sending it in because of my feelings over the way the church is forging ahead with this big project (especially when my wife and I have been struggling financially etc). My question is two-fold and is as follows: 1) Can tithes only be given to CHURCHES or can a contribution to other ministries or the needy or poor also be considered a tithe? and 2) If a tighe can only be given to a church does it have to be given to the church you attend or can it (for example) be given to a church your relatives attend (and speak very highly of). Just looking for some alternatives to cheerful tithing. |
